Responsibilities

The Eeg Technician Trainee

responsibilities include, but are not limited to, the following:

Performs EEGs including portable recordings and is introduced to telephonic and remote EEGs Assists with electro cerebral silence recordings (ECS) for the determination of brain death and ICU monitoring Obtains all pertinent and relevant patient history for electroencephalographers Observes and assists while the electroencephalographers are reading tracings Answers phone inquires, schedules appointments, maintains files and charging for test procedures Maintains equipment and is responsible for self study in preparation to become an EEG technologist I

The occurrence to be in contact with bodily fluids from patients. Required to wear universal protective clothing when in contact with highly contagious and infectious patients. The occurrence to jam fingers and hands while maneuvering machines is highly feasible. Potential for bodily injury related to lifting and transferring patients. When applying electrodes, using collodion, caution should be used, since this substance is highly flammable and produces noxious fumes. To clean the scalp electrode, they are soaked in sodium hypochlorite, which has noxious fumes and tends to stain personal clothing.
